# RecurringProductParams.Builder

```
public final class RecurringProductParams.Builder extends Object
```

```
java.lang.Object
    ↳ com.gaa.sdk.iap.RecurringProductParams.Builder
```

<br>

[RecurringProductParams](https://onestore-dev.gitbook.io/dev/tools/billing/old-version/v19/undefined-3/classes/recurringproductparams)의 인스턴스를 쉽게 만들기 위한 빌더입니다.

## Public methods <a href="#recurringproductparams.builder-publicmethods" id="recurringproductparams.builder-publicmethods"></a>

***

### setPurchaseData <a href="#recurringproductparams.builder-setpurchasedata" id="recurringproductparams.builder-setpurchasedata"></a>

```
RecurringProductParams.Builder setPurchaseData( purchaseData)
```

| **Parameters:**                |             |
| ------------------------------ | ----------- |
| purchaseData                   | <p><br></p> |
| **Returns:**                   |             |
| RecurringProductParams.Builder | <p><br></p> |

### setRecurringAction <a href="#recurringproductparams.builder-setrecurringaction" id="recurringproductparams.builder-setrecurringaction"></a>

```
RecurringProductParams.Builder setRecurringAction(String action)
```

<table data-header-hidden><thead><tr><th></th><th></th></tr></thead><tbody><tr><td><strong>Parameters:</strong></td><td></td></tr><tr><td><pre><code>action
</code></pre></td><td><p>월정액 상품의 상태를 변경하고 싶은 액션명 입니다.</p><p><a href="../annotations/purchaseclient.recurringaction">PurchaseClient.RecurringAction</a></p></td></tr><tr><td><strong>Returns:</strong></td><td></td></tr><tr><td>RecurringProductParams.Builder</td><td><br></td></tr></tbody></table>

### build <a href="#recurringproductparams.builder-build" id="recurringproductparams.builder-build"></a>

```
 build()
```

RecurringProductParams의 인스턴스를 생성합니다.

| **Returns:**                                                           |             |
| ---------------------------------------------------------------------- | ----------- |
| <p><a href="recurringproductparams">RecurringProductParams</a><br></p> | <p><br></p> |
